Location
Park Road is one of the most sought after roads in Tring, for character properties and overlooks paddock land. It's located approximately five minutes walk from Tring's charming High Street which sees independently run shops, cafes and restaurants alongside well known High Street brands such as Marks & Spencer and Costa Coffee. The Farmers market in Church Square is held every Friday. Tring is surrounded by beautiful Chilterns countryside providing endless walks and the Grand Union Canal runs along the edge of town. Tring Park is an expansive green space of fields and woodland which hikers and dog walkers will make a bee line for. The train station offers a fast and frequent service to London Euston (approximately 38 minutes) as well as Milton Keynes and the north, making Tring a popular choice for commuters. The A41 dual carriageway can be joined at Tring, linking the M25 motorway at junction 20 giving convenient access to the London airports.
Tring offers a choice of infant and primary schools, and the recently modernised Tring Secondary School. There is also Tring School for the Performing Arts in town and further private education at Berkhamsted School five miles away. Sports enthusiasts will be glad to hear there is something for everyone, a public sports centre and several gyms, football, cricket, rugby, tennis and bowls clubs and an abundance of excellent golf courses in the nearby area.
